Finding the proper jewelry to compliment your clothing can be difficult, but with a few basic criteria, you can quickly locate the ideal pieces to complete your style. The idea is to find a balance and make sure your jewelry accentuates rather than overpowers your clothing.

First, analyze your clothing's neckline. Wear dramatic earrings or a striking bracelet with a high-necked shirt or dress to bring attention to your face and wrists. An elegant necklace or pendant will give a touch of refinement to your attire if you have a low neckline.

Assess the color scheme accordingly. If your clothing is mostly neutral, you may add an unexpected pop of color with accessories. If your clothes are already vivid or patterned, consider more understated jewelry that enhances rather than clashes with your ensemble.

Finally, think about the event and your own unique style. For a formal occasion, choose more traditional and refined jewelry, such as diamond studs or pearls. For a more informal event, though, you may have fun with fashionable and varied pieces that represent your personality.

The balance of colors is an important part of the jewelry aesthetic. You may get a harmonious and unified style by coordinating the colors of your jewelry with your clothes. Here are a few pointers to help you master the art of color matching:

Complementary: Select jewelry in shades that are contrary to the most noticeable color of your clothing on the color wheel. If you're wearing a blue outfit, use jewelry with orange or yellow undertones.

Choose jewelry in the same color family but in various hues or textures if your outfit is mostly one color. This results in a polished and beautiful monotone appearance.

Metallic jewelry: Don't overlook metallic jewelry. These tones such as silver, gold, rose gold, and others may bring a bit of glitz and refinement to any ensemble. Gold jewelry goes well with warm-toned ensembles, whereas silver jewelry goes well with cool-toned outfits.

Remember that color harmonization does not require all components to match precisely. Explore several pairings and follow your intuition. Unexpected combos may sometimes result in the most striking outfits.

Layering and stacking are two of the most recent jewelry style trends. Wearing many necklaces, bracelets, or rings together creates a distinctive and appealing style. Here are some suggestions that will assist you perfect the art of jewelry layering and stacking:

Mix different lengths: Begin by selecting necklaces of varying lengths. Layer a choker with a pendant necklace or delicate strands of varied lengths. This gives your appearance depth and dimension.

Play with various finishes and varieties: Explore different textures and styles of jewelry. For an intense appearance, blend dainty chains with larger bold pieces or metals. Adding a few gemstones or pearl embellishments to your layered jewelry can also boost it.

Match the proportions: When layering bracelets or rings, keep the proportions in mind. To generate a striking impression, mix thin and thick bands or stack various types. Just be careful not to smother your wrist or fingers.

Layering and stacking jewelry allows you to express your imagination while developing a one-of-a-kind aesthetic. Don't be scared of combining various pieces to get a look that's right for you.

Mixing and combining various kinds of jewelry is yet another method to improve your style. The days of wearing only one sort of jewelry are over. You may create an energetic and aesthetically attractive appearance by mixing several elements. Here are a few pointers to help you grasp the art of mixing and matching:

Set dramatic earrings with a dainty necklace. If you have a set of big statement earrings, combine them with a delicate necklace or pendant. This produces a balanced aesthetic and guarantees both of the pieces are striking.

Feel free to mix metals! Pairing metals is no longer a fashion mistake. In fact, it may give your whole outfit a trendy and gritty feel. For a stunning addition, combine gold and silver or rose gold and white gold.

Play with multiple textures. Don't be scared to experiment with different textures. Layer a textured cuff with a streamlined bangle or a large beaded bracelet with a dainty chain. This increases the aesthetic appeal and depth of your jewelry.

Understand that creating a unified style is the secret to effective mixing and matching. Choose jewelry that has a similar aspect, such as color, texture, or style. This guarantees that your jewelry seems purposeful rather than hastily slapped together.

Styling for particular looks necessitates a different approach. Whether you're getting ready for a casual day out, an official gathering, or an important event, here are some styling suggestions to help you look your best:

Casual attire: The emphasis for casual clothing is on generating a comfortable and easy look. Choose delicate jewelry that provides a touch of refinement without overwhelming your ensemble. Layering delicate necklaces, stacking simple rings, and matching little hoop earrings with a charm bracelet might be the ideal complement to your casual outfit.

Formal attire: Formal attire demands more complex and showy pieces. Choose traditional and timeless items like diamond studs, a pearl necklace, or a striking cocktail ring. To prevent overpowering your ensemble, maintain your attention on one or two crucial elements.

Special Occasions: Special occasions call for accessories that convey an emotion. Don't be scared to make bold and striking choices. Choose chandelier earrings, a striking necklace, or a diamond bracelet. Simply ensure that your jewelry complements your attire and does not overshadow it.

Whenever it concerns jewelry style, it's critical to keep your physical characteristics and facial shape in mind in order to get a unified and pleasing aesthetic. Here are some pointers to consider while selecting jewelry for your body type and facial shape:

For an hourglass bodies choose jewelry that enhances your waistline if you have an hourglass form with clearly defined contours. Choose a striking belt, a pendant necklace that falls to your chest, or a bracelet that draws attention to your wrists.

For pear-shaped bodies attract emphasis upwards with statement earrings or a dramatic necklace for pear-shaped bodies with smaller shoulders and broader hips. Avoid wearing bulky bracelets or rings, which can make your lower body look larger.

Apple-shaped bodies, which have a broader waist, can draw emphasis to their neckline and wrists. To achieve a balanced and extended style, choose lengthy pendant necklaces, striking cuffs, or stackable rings.

Round faces should pick jewelry that adds angles and lengthens your face if you have a round face. Long earrings, drop necklaces, or geometric designs that generate vertical lines are all good choices.

Oval faces are adaptable and may wear a variety of jewelry designs. Play with varying lengths and styles to see what looks best on you.

Heart-shaped features might benefit from jewelry that combines the width of the forehead and the small diameter of the chin. Chandelier earrings, stacked necklaces, or striking rings that attract focus downward are all good choices.
